According to MSNBC, the game in question was a popular recess pastime at Washington Elementary School in New Ulm, Minnesota. According to a letter from the principal, rape tag was "similar to freeze tag except that a person had to be humped to be unfrozen." School officials learned about the game from an outraged parent of a fifth grader — and, to their credit, it looks like they took quick action. The principal's letter says that fifth grade teachers talked to their classes about rape tag, and all school staff were told to watch for and stop any incidents of the game. It also says the kids appear to have quit playing.
